  Calpain-1, Human Erythrocytes
Cat. No. 208713  
All Categories » Calbiochem » Proteins and Enzymes » Proteases » Calpains

m-Calpain

Liquid. In 20 mM imidazole, 5 mM b-mercaptoethanol, 1 mM EDTA, 1 mM EGTA, 30% glycerol, pH 6.8. AVOID FREEZE/THAW CYCLES. Native calpain-1 from human erythrocytes. Ca2+-dependent heterodimeric cysteine proteinase with low Ca2+ requirement (EC50= 2 µM). Specific activity: ≥1000 units/mg protein. One unit is defined as the amount of enzyme that will hydrolyze 1 pmol Suc-LLVY-AMC in 1 min, 25°C using the Calpain Activity Assay Kit, Fluorogenic (Cat. No. QIA120). Note: 1 caseinolytic unit = 1 fluorogenic unit. Purity: Comparable to reference lot by SDS-PAGE.. Prepared from blood that has been shown by certified tests to be negative for HBsAg and for antibodies to HIV and HCV. EC 3.4.22.17.

Ref.: Vanderklish, P.W., and Bahr, B.A. 2000. Int. J. Exp. Pathol. 81, 323. Sorimachi, H., et al. 1997. Biochem. J. 328, 721. Croall, D.E., and McGrody, K.S. 1994. Biochemistry 33, 13223.
